What is a professional behavior?
Professional behaviour is a form of etiquette in the workplace that is linked primarily to respectful and courteous conduct. Being conscious of how you treat co-workers and clients, and ensuring a positive workplace attitude can help you to improve your productivity and effectiveness in the workplace.
Why is it important to have professional behavior?
Although it can be challenging to establish boundaries in personal relationships, it is essential to establish boundaries in the workplace. Everyone has a role to play in an organization. Professional behavior helps separate business from the personal; it keeps relationships limited to the business context at hand.
